A sinking or damaged foundation can cause serious problems for your home. While some repairs handle the issue from below, sometimes the best solution is to lift the entire house. House lifting provides a way to stabilize an unstable building, allowing for extensive foundation repairs. This process commonly includes specialized equipment to carefully lift the house, ensuring minimal damage during the transition. Once lifted, the base can be repaired or replaced, stabilizing your home's future.
Moving A House: Cost Considerations
Figuring out the price for lifting a house can be tricky. There's no one-size-fits-all response as the cost is heavily influenced by a variety of elements. The size and weight of your house, the complexity of the move, your location, and the skill level of the contractors you choose will all play a role.
Generally speaking, expect to invest anywhere from tens of thousands to well over a significant amount of dollars for a house lift. This can include costs for permits, engineering, equipment rentals, labor, and any necessary repairs or adjustments made to the structure after lifting.
- Elements impacting the cost might include:
- The structure's size and weight
- The distance lift required
- Ease of access
- Soil conditions
- Permitting requirements
It's highly recommended to obtain multiple bids from reputable contractors and discuss your specific needs completely before making a decision.

Raising Your Home: DIY vs. Professionals Decision
Deciding whether to tackle a house raising project yourself or hire professionals can be a tough call. Both options have their benefits and challenges.
A DIY approach can save costs, allowing you to control the process from start to finish. However, it requires a high level of knowledge and strenuous labor. Mistakes can be costly and hazardous, maybe leading to structural damage or even injury.
Conversely, professional services offer peace of mind knowing the job will be done correctly and safely. They have the resources and experience to handle complex circumstances. While it may cost more upfront investment, professionals can assure a smoother process and long-term durability.
Ultimately, the best method depends on your individual needs, budget, and level of comfort with DIY projects. Carefully weigh the dangers and rewards before making your final choice.

Raising A House: The Science Behind the Process
House lifting is a complex engineering feat that involves carefully transferring a structure to a new elevation. This companies that lift houses process typically entails stabilizing the existing foundation with temporary supports, then gradually elevating the building using hydraulic jacks or other specialized equipment.
The depth of the lift depends on the specific needs of the project, which could range from a few inches to several feet. Constructors meticulously design the lifting process to ensure the structural integrity of the house is maintained throughout the procedure.
A key aspect of house lifting involves adjusting for changes in soil conditions, as moving earth can create uneven loads on the foundation. Devices are often used to monitor these shifts in real-time, allowing engineers to make necessary modifications to the lifting process.
- After the house has been raised to the desired elevation, the foundation is then solidified with concrete or other suitable materials.
- Connections are reconnected and adjusted as needed.
- Finally, the house undergoes a thorough inspection to ensure that it is structurally sound and ready for occupancy.

Signs That Time to Call a House Lifting Specialist
Your foundation is sinking faster than a lead weight in the ocean. You might need to call a house lifting specialist if your floors are becoming uneven or you notice doors and windows jamming. Additionally, cracks forming in your foundation can be a major indication that your house needs some serious attention. Don't wait until the situation becomes worse. Prompt intervention from a professional can save you time, money, and a whole lot of stress in the long run.
